Sponsor's own description
The purpose of this study was to explore the predictive value of the heterogeneity of 68Ga-FAPI PET-CT uptake before treatment on the response of T-DXd treatment in patients with brain metastases of HER2-positive breast cancer. The patient underwent 68Ga-FAPI PET-CT examinations within 2 weeks before and after 2 cycles of T-DXd treatment. Heterogeneity index, SUVmax, SUVmean and other uptake values were collected to investigate the association with efficacy of T-DXd.
